查询单条语句:用来获取用户列表和单个用户>>>fields=["id","name","name_cn","email","mobile"]
>>>sql="select%sfromuserswherename=‘admin‘"%‘,‘.join(fields)
>>>sql
"selectid,name,name_cn,email,mobilefromuserswherename=‘admin‘"
>>..
分类:
数据库 时间:
2016-08-18 14:41:52
阅读次数:
200
ROWNUM的概念ROWNUM是一个虚假的列。它将被分配为 1,2,3,4,...N,N 是行的数量。一个ROWNUM值不是被永久的分配给一行 (这是最容易被误解的)。表中的某一行并没有标号;你不可以查询ROWNUM值为5的行——根本没有这个概念。另一个容易搞糊涂的问题是ROWNUM值是何时被分配的 ...
分类:
数据库 时间:
2016-08-17 23:03:04
阅读次数:
206
参考文章: 如何优化sql语句(ORACLE) 浅谈MySQL中优化sql语句查询常用的30种方法 MySQL性能优化的21个最佳实践 和 mysql使用索引 ...
分类:
数据库 时间:
2016-08-14 23:53:44
阅读次数:
188
查询优化是传统数据库中最为重要的一环,这项技术在传统数据库中已经很成熟。除了查询优化, Spark SQL 在存储上也进行了优化,从以下几点查看 Spark SQL 的一些优化策略。 (1)内存列式存储与内存缓存表 Spark SQL 可以通过 cacheTable 将数据存储转换为列式存储,同时将 ...
分类:
数据库 时间:
2016-08-01 12:15:17
阅读次数:
601
下面总结了一些工作常见的sql优化例子,虽然比较简单,但很实用,希望对大家有所帮助。sql优化一般分为两类,一类是sql本身的优化,如何走到合适的索引,如何减少排序,减少逻辑读;另一类是sql本身没有优化余地,需要结合业务场景进行优化。即在满足业务需求的情况下对sql进行改造,已提高sql执行速度, ...
分类:
数据库 时间:
2016-07-19 18:50:52
阅读次数:
238
随着企业数据库的急剧膨胀和日益复杂,DBA为保证数据库性能所付出的努力与日俱增,手工或使用多种无法集成的管理工具,都会给日常管理和维护带来不必要的困难。 Quest Central for Databases
是一种集成化、图形化、跨平台的数据库管理解决方案,可以管理异构环境下的 Oracle、DB2
和 SQL server 数据库。Quest Central for Databases
...
分类:
数据库 时间:
2016-07-19 13:46:31
阅读次数:
365
本文整理了一些MySQL的通用优化方法,做个简单的总结分享,旨在帮助那些没有专职MySQL DBA的企业做好基本的优化工作,至于具体的SQL优化,大部分通过加适当的索引即可达到效果,更复杂的就需要具体分析了。 1、硬件层相关优化 1.1、CPU相关 在服务器的BIOS设置中,可调整下面的几个配置,目 ...
分类:
数据库 时间:
2016-07-19 09:52:26
阅读次数:
176
优化前语句:SELECTifnull(s.mileage,-1)asmile,s.fuel_hkmasval,t.fhkm_rankasrank,ifnull((selectu.photofromapp_useruwhereu.user_id=t.user_idlimit1),‘‘)aspath,casewhens.car_id=‘***********‘then0else1endasself,ifnull((SELECTcasewhenifnull(u.nickname,‘‘)!=‘‘thenu..
分类:
数据库 时间:
2016-07-17 02:42:10
阅读次数:
265
现在所在公司使用的是SQL SERVER数据库,所以想精通SQL查询和SQL优化
本文转载自这里写链接内容概述:独立子查询
相关子查询
关键词解释:外部查询:查询结果集返回给调用者内部查询:查询结果集返回给外部查询。独立子查询:独立子查询独立于其外部查询的子查询,可以单独运行子查询。在逻辑上,独立子查询在执行外部查询之前先执行一次,接着外部查询再使用子查询的结果继续进行查询。相关子查询:引用了...
分类:
其他好文 时间:
2016-07-17 00:06:02
阅读次数:
541
ORACLE的提示功能是比较强的功能,也是比较复杂的应用,并且提示只是给ORACLE执行的一个建议,有时如果 出于成本方面的考虑ORACLE也可能不会按提示进行。根据实践应用,一般不建议开发人员应用ORACLE提示,因为各 个数据库及服务器性能情况不一样,很可能一个地方性能提升了,但另一个地方却下降 ...
分类:
数据库 时间:
2016-07-15 13:42:46
阅读次数:
143